LLVM#
LLVM has been provided for use on the system by the llvm module.
It has been built with CUDA GPU offloading support, allowing OpenMP
regions to run on a GPU using the target directive.
Note that, as from LLVM 11.0.0, it provides a Fortran compiler called
flang. Although this has been compiled and can be used for
experimentation, it is still immature and ultimately relies on
gfortran for its code generation. The lvm/11.0.0 module therefore
defaults to using the operating system provided gfortran, instead.
module load llvm
module load llvm/11.0.0
For further information please see the LLVM Releases for versioned documentation.
